Design features and construction progress for San Luis Canal in central California are described; canal will be over 100 mi long and have initial capacity of about 13,100 cu fps when completed; unreinforced concrete lining, 4 1/2 in. thick, was selected because it allowed smaller cross section; details of slip-forming operation, special equipment used, and special joints developed to reduce leakage; concrete mixes and aggregate gradings especially developed for slip-form paving are described.
